Output 12cfbf77dd1da13ae474413e21cfc36f7df31f3d97706293a5188fcb19beda14:83

value
43954
script pubkey
OP_0 OP_PUSHBYTES_20 ddd3fc164cb894a36d9623a60e0e29fe14e51dd2
address
bc1qmhflc9jvhz22xmvkywnqur3flc2w28wj7ldz80
transaction
12cfbf77dd1da13ae474413e21cfc36f7df31f3d97706293a5188fcb19beda14
spent
true